Definition of Speaks

noun

  1. Language, jargon, or terminology used uniquely in a particular environment or group.

    "Corporate speak; IT speak."

  2. Speech, conversation.

verb

  1. To communicate with one's voice, to say words out loud.

    "I was so surprised I couldn't speak."

  2. To have a conversation.

    "It's been ages since we've spoken."

  3. (by extension) To communicate or converse by some means other than orally, such as writing or facial expressions.

    "Actions speak louder than words."

  4. To deliver a message to a group; to deliver a speech.

    "This evening I shall speak on the topic of correct English usage."

  5. To be able to communicate in a language.

    "He speaks Mandarin fluently."
